88问答网
所有问题
当前搜索:
keil5中sprintf函数的用法
keil
单片机如何把int转换成char
答:
1、使用类型转换操作符将int强制转换为char类型。2、使用
sprintf
()
函数
将int转换为char类型。
51下
keil
中有没有字符串转换的
函数
答:
sprintf可以在code空间足够时用来玩玩,目的是将数据变成字符串打印到数组
,比如小数54.3会变成'5','4','.','3',不过太耗资源,不如自己写一个函数HEXtoBCD(int number,uchar per),取第几个就直接填进去。或者define也不错
在
KEIL中
用C写51的程序,如何将int型数据转换为相应的十进制ASCII码...
答:
可以通过取余操作取出每一位的数字,依次加上0x30后存入buffer即可
keil
c中如何将整型转化为字符串
答:
可以使用sscanf,就像
sprintf
将整型数转换成字符串输出一样,逆运算(
KEIL
C 中scanf和printf确定了通过单片机串行口完成输入输出模式,除非做了修改,一般实际中不用)。给你个例子:unsigned char string[5]={"1234"};unsigned int n;sscanf(string,"%u",&n);//string是字符串,%u是格式控制串,u是...
keil
里的
sprintf函数
怎么把整型换成浮点型
答:
可以直接通过强制转换的形式进行强转。 _纾_loat a =2.22f; int c = Integer.valueOf(a);结果就是:2; 如:float a =2.22f; int c = (int)a;结果也是:2;_ǔJ道嘈偷那恐谱患纯赏ü鲜隽街址绞降囊恢滞瓿勺患纯伞?
C51里用过
sprintf函数的
请进
答:
UINT8 cstrFormat[8] = {0};UINT8 tempBuffer[8] = {0};
sprintf
(cstrFormat,"%%%bdld",Length);sprintf(tempBuffer,cstrFormat,Value);DisplayTxt(tempBuffer,BaseAddr,Length);可以考虑换一种方法,如先将数据写到另一个变量中,再进行前补空格,自己写个
函数
就可以了 ...
关于在
Keil
c中使用
sprintf函数的
问题
答:
因为
Keil
采用的库
函数
是精简库,功能没有VC那么强大,具体到
sprintf
来说,字符串总长度不能超过15个字节,你第一种满足,第二种超了,其实还有些方面也没VC那么强
C语言,
sprintf
(table,"%.4f",angle[0]);
答:
直接复制的在那一句最后边多了两个字符 去掉后编译无错 请检查你是否输入错误,没有错误的话请更换最新版
keil
C51。还有就是51对浮点型的运算是调用库执行的,效率很低,建议优化,还有
sprintf函数
虽然使用方便,但是编译后占用2k空间,对51这种flash不大的单片机来说比较浪费,建议尽量不用,自己写的会...
keil
C51相关内容?
答:
a = 75; b = a/6;
sprintf
(table4,"%lf",b);你得检查执行这两句后,看看 table4[]里面的数据,是否与显示的不一致;
如何在
Keil中
加入
printf函数
答:
对于有串口的CPU, 可以使用自制的printf()将输出定向到串口上去。printf()的自制方法可以参考x
sprintf
()的做法。
1
2
3
涓嬩竴椤
其他人还搜
keil5的printf打印在哪
keil5的sprintf要怎么才能用
c语言sprintf函数用法
51单片机sprintf函数的用法
sprintf函数用法详解
keil5打印输出
sprintf函数的用法
vsprintf函数的用法
keil5结果在串口输出显示